Hi,

kernel test robot noticed the following build warnings:

[auto build test WARNING on jic23-iio/togreg]
[also build test WARNING on linus/master v6.7-rc2 next-20231122]

All warnings (new ones prefixed by >>):

   In file included from drivers/iio/adc/ad7091r-base.c:16:
>> drivers/iio/adc/ad7091r-base.h:41:36: warning: 'ad7091r_events' defined but not used [-Wunused-const-variable=]
      41 | static const struct iio_event_spec ad7091r_events[] = {
         |                                    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~


vim +/ad7091r_events +41 drivers/iio/adc/ad7091r-base.h

    40	
  > 41	static const struct iio_event_spec ad7091r_events[] = {
    42		{
    43			.type = IIO_EV_TYPE_THRESH,
    44			.dir = IIO_EV_DIR_RISING,
    45			.mask_separate = BIT(IIO_EV_INFO_VALUE) |
    46					 BIT(IIO_EV_INFO_ENABLE),
    47		},
    48		{
    49			.type = IIO_EV_TYPE_THRESH,
    50			.dir = IIO_EV_DIR_FALLING,
    51			.mask_separate = BIT(IIO_EV_INFO_VALUE) |
    52					 BIT(IIO_EV_INFO_ENABLE),
    53		},
    54		{
    55			.type = IIO_EV_TYPE_THRESH,
    56			.dir = IIO_EV_DIR_EITHER,
    57			.mask_separate = BIT(IIO_EV_INFO_HYSTERESIS),
    58		},
    59	};
    60
